Facebook removes multiple accounts from Nigeria, UAE, Egypt and Indonesia

Facebook Inc has removed several pages, groups and accounts on its platforms from the United Arab Emirates, Egypt, Nigeria and Indonesia, citing “coordinated inauthentic behavior”. A total of 280 Facebook accounts, 149 pages and 43 groups, and 121 Instagram accounts were removed, the social media platform said on Thursday. Facebook, which owns one-time rivals Instagram and […]

Kajuru attack: Police Reveals How Briton, Miss Mooney, was killed.

The Nigerian Police Force (NPF) has withdrawn the Police Mobile Force (PMF) personnel previously attached to prominent individuals.

The Police Command in Kaduna State has identified the expatriate killed by suspected kidnappers in Kajuru as Miss Faye Mooney, a Briton. The Command’s Public Relation Officer, DSP Yakubu Sabo disclosed this to the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) on Sunday in Kaduna. Mooney was among the two people killed and three kidnapped on April […]

How four Boko Haram suspects were arrested in Auchi

The Edo State Police at the weekend in Benin explained how four members of the dreaded Boko Haram Islamic sect were nabbed at Auchi, Etsako West local government area of the state. In a statement by the spokesman, Mr Chidi Nwanbuzor, he said that their arrest was based on credible intelligence from the Department State […]

Sudan’s President and Chairman of Muslim Brotherhood-Linked National Congress Party Ousted by Military

(New York, N.Y.) – The Counter Extremism Project (CEP) today released updated resources on Sudan’s National Congress Party (NCP), the successor organization to the Muslim Brotherhood-affiliated National Islamic Front (NIF). Recently deposed Sudanese President and NCP chairman Omar Hassan Ahmed al-Bashir currently stands accused of crimes against humanity, war crimes, and genocide for his violence against religious and ethnic groups throughout […]
